Skip to content

Missing semanticdb occurrence for annonymous using #11498

Closed
@tgodzik

Description

@tgodzik

Compiler version

3.0.0-RC1

Minimized code

package a

trait Foo

def bar(using Foo) = 42

Output

src/main/scala/Test.scala
-------------------------

Summary:
Schema => SemanticDB v4
Uri => src/main/scala/Test.scala
Text => empty
Language => Scala
Symbols => 5 entries
Occurrences => 5 entries

Symbols:
a/Foo# => trait Foo
a/Foo#`<init>`(). => primary ctor <init>
a/Test$package. => final package object a
a/Test$package.bar(). => method bar
a/Test$package.bar().(x$1) => implicit param x$1

Occurrences:
[0:8..0:9) <= a/
[2:0..2:0) <= a/Foo#`<init>`().
[2:6..2:9) <= a/Foo#
[4:0..4:0) <= a/Test$package.
[4:4..4:7) <= a/Test$package.bar().

Expectation

src/main/scala/Test.scala
-------------------------

Summary:
Schema => SemanticDB v4
Uri => src/main/scala/Test.scala
Text => empty
Language => Scala
Symbols => 5 entries
Occurrences => 5 entries

Symbols:
a/Foo# => trait Foo
a/Foo#`<init>`(). => primary ctor <init>
a/Test$package. => final package object a
a/Test$package.bar(). => method bar
a/Test$package.bar().(x$1) => implicit param x$1

Occurrences:
[0:8..0:9) <= a/
[2:0..2:0) <= a/Foo#`<init>`().
[2:6..2:9) <= a/Foo#
[4:0..4:0) <= a/Test$package.
[4:4..4:7) <= a/Test$package.bar().
[4:14..4:17) <= a/Foo#

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ions